  • Abstract
    This paper proposes a parameter-dependent approach to robust fault detection and estimation problem for linear time-invariant (LTI) systems. The unknown input, actuator faults, sensor faults and disturbances are considered in our design. Through projection lemma, we provide a sufficient affine matrix inequality for the integrated system in order to achieve robust performance criterion. In stead of obtaining the optimal solution by quadratic approach, we have used a parameter-dependent lyapunov approach which aimed at eliminating the involved coupling between system matrices and the lyapunov matrices; hence the conservativeness due to quadratic approach can be dramatically reduced. We present a design example in which we apply our method to a helicopter model.
